- WinCE Security...
- xdebug配置说明
- VC++ 获取文件的创建、修...
- ASP进度条
- 简单代理服务器C代码实现(S...
- 程序设计竞赛试题选(02)
- 如何在ASP程序中打印Acc...
- UTF-8和16进制区间
- ASP实用技巧:强制刷新和判...
- 运行中程序删除自己的方法
- asp提高首页性能的一个技巧
- [J2EE]J2EE 应用服务器技术
- VB变量命名规范
- C语言常见错误小结
- (摘自网络)如何在IIS中调...
如何将sql server2005 中的数据库转换成sql server2000 详细步骤
第一步:在SQL2005中生成脚本文件
① 在2005中选中要进行转换的那个数据库,鼠标“右键”选择—“属性”—“选项”:修改“兼容级别”为“SQL Server 2000 (80)”;
② 选择您要导出的数据库,鼠标“右键”—“任务”—“生成脚本”;
注意:这里要选择“为所选数据库中的所有对象编写脚本”,否则后面在SQL2000导入数据时会出现下面的错误,将导致导入数据失败!!!
③ 下一步:这里的“为服务器版本编写脚本”要选择:SQL Server 2000; 填写用户名,密码,选择数据库,点击“下一步”;
④ 选中SQL2005数据脚本生成方式,一般选中“将脚本保存到文件”,这样好找一些。
⑤ 脚本文件生成成功!会生成一个“.sql”脚本文件。
第二步:在SQL2000中执行上一步生成的脚步文件
① 在SQL2000中新建一个与脚本生成的数据库同名的数据库,如果之前数据库里面有相关的表和视图,请先全部清空。
② 选中刚刚新建的空数据库,然后点击菜单栏中的“工具”菜单下的“SQL查询分析器”,在弹出的空白查询分析器内,上一步生成的脚步的内容复制到空白的查询分析器内。
③ 点击“√”按钮,即查询的“分析”按钮,对刚刚复制过来的脚步内容进行分析,一般会出现错误:“max”附近有错误,因为在SQL2000中没有nvchar长度,这里只需要把[nvchar](max)改成[ntext]即可,再检查一遍,脚本没有错误,再点击“运行”(三角符号)按钮,即可生成数据库内的表。执行完了之后,状态栏那里不能出现有错误!
第三步:将SQL2005中是数据导入到SQL2000中去
① 在SQL2000中选中刚刚完成的那个需要导入数据的数据库,鼠标“右键”==所有任务=====导入数据;
② 输入正确的服务器IP、数据库账号和密码,再点刷新,然后选中2005中要导入的数据所做的数据库,下一步;
③ 选中2000中被导入数据的数据库,下一步;
④ 选中一种方式,一般是“从源数据库复制表和视图”再下一步;
⑤ 选择要导入的表,下一步,立即运行,完成。运行完了之后,如果有个别表不能正常导入,请重试一次即可。